Output b8c1deb2151bf884761672788814169e263f7caeac96480f410fb50f1dd6c51f:16

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d51121978fd6ae305ca0702242251a65a8199d1 OP_EQUAL
address
3G2q8YyrJfWKBdAp2mHmL1nMBCYWNTUoo4
transaction
b8c1deb2151bf884761672788814169e263f7caeac96480f410fb50f1dd6c51f
confirmations
502518
spent
true